Php.ini设置: session.name

Php.ini设置: session.name

Php.ini设置: session.name

在PHP中,session.name是一个非常重要的配置选项,它用于设置会话ID的名称。会话ID是用于跟踪用户在网站上的活动的唯一标识符。通过设置session.name,您可以自定义会话ID的名称,以增加安全性和隐私保护。

为什么要设置session.name?

默认情况下,PHP会将会话ID存储在名为PHPSESSID的cookie中。这使得攻击者可以轻松地识别出使用PHP的网站,并尝试利用会话劫持等安全漏洞。为了增加安全性,您可以通过设置session.name来自定义会话ID的名称,使其不易被攻击者识别。

如何设置session.name?

要设置session.name,您需要编辑php.ini文件。php.ini是PHP的配置文件,用于设置各种PHP选项。您可以在服务器上找到php.ini文件,并使用文本编辑器打开它。

在php.ini文件中,您可以找到一个名为session.name的选项。默认情况下,它的值是”PHPSESSID”。您可以将其更改为任何您喜欢的名称。例如,您可以将其更改为”MYSESSIONID”。

以下是一个示例php.ini文件中session.name的设置:


session.name = MYSESSIONID

保存php.ini文件并重新启动您的Web服务器,以使更改生效。

设置session.name的最佳实践

在设置session.name时,有几个最佳实践值得注意:

  • 选择一个不容易被猜测的名称,以增加安全性。
  • 避免使用与其他网站相同的会话ID名称,以防止冲突。
  • 确保您的会话ID名称符合PHP变量命名规则。

总结

通过设置session.name,您可以自定义PHP会话ID的名称,以增加安全性和隐私保护。通过选择一个不容易被猜测的名称,您可以减少会话劫持等安全漏洞的风险。如果您想了解更多关于PHP会话管理的信息,请访问我们的官方网站。

香港服务器首选晴川云

晴川云是一家专业的云计算公司,提供各种云服务器解决方案,包括香港服务器美国服务器和云服务器。我们的香港服务器是首选之一,提供高性能和可靠性,适用于各种网站和应用程序。如果您正在寻找可靠的香港服务器提供商,请考虑选择晴川云。

了解更多关于我们的香港服务器解决方案,请访问我们的官方网站:https://www.qcidc.com

原创文章,作者:晴川运维,如若转载,请注明出处:https://baike.qcidc.com/12059.html

(0)
晴川运维晴川运维
上一篇 5天前
下一篇 5天前

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注